Technology flavor - تكنولوجي فلافور is located in Giza Governorate, Egypt on طريق النسايم ، قسم أول 6 أكتوبر، اول 6 أكتوبر،. Technology flavor - تكنولوجي فلافور is rated 5 out of 5 in the category home automation company in Egypt.
Address
طريق النسايم ، قسم أول 6 أكتوبر، اول 6 أكتوبر،